ContextHub
データベース・データ分析完全無料🔓 APIキー不要uvx

DuckDB MCP Server

DuckDB MCPサーバーでClaude連携・高速分析クエリを自動化

最終更新:2026年3月27日
クイックインストール
uvx duckdb-mcp

概要

DuckDB MCP Serverの設定方法と使い方

高速インプロセス分析データベース「DuckDB」をClaudeから操作できるMCPサーバー

SQLクエリの実行・CSVやParquetファイルの直接読み込み・集計分析・スキーマ確認が可能

ClaudeとDuckDBのMCPサーバー連携により、ローカルファイルのデータ分析・大規模CSVの集計処理を自動化できる

インストール不要でローカル実行できるため、データサイエンスワークフローに最適

設定方法はDuckDBファイルパスを設定するだけでシンプルに完結する

料金・APIキー情報

料金

完全無料

DuckDBはオープンソース・完全無料。MCPサーバーも無料

料金詳細を見る →

APIキー

🔓 不要

このMCPはAPIキー不要です。別途セットアップが必要な場合があります(上記参照)。

こんな使い方ができます

CSVやParquetファイルをClaudeに読み込ませてSQLで集計・分析させられる

DuckDBデータベースのスキーマをClaudeが確認してクエリを自動生成できる

大規模データセットをClaudeが高速集計してレポートを作成できる

複数ファイルをJOINしてClaudeがデータ統合・変換処理を実行できる

セットアップ手順

  1. 1

    Python環境(uv推奨)がインストールされていることを確認する

  2. 2

    claude mcp add duckdb -e DUCKDB_PATH=/path/to/database.duckdb -- uvx duckdb-mcp

  3. 3

    Claudeで「DuckDBに接続してテーブル一覧を表示して」と指示して動作確認する

設定ファイル

⚠️

コピー前に確認

Python(uv)のインストールが必要。DuckDBアカウント不要。DuckDBファイルまたはCSV/Parquetファイルへのアクセス権限が必要。

Terminal
claude mcp add duckdb -e DUCKDB_PATH=/path/to/your/database.duckdb -- uvx duckdb-mcp
#DuckDB#SQL#データ分析#Parquet#CSV

外部リンク

関連するMCPサーバー(データベース・データ分析